Provident’s work supporting the mental health of older adults was recently featured by Washington University’s Center for Aging. The spotlight highlights how Provident provides therapy services to clients ages 55 and older, addressing challenges such as isolation, grief, anxiety, and depression.
As the article explains, these services help older adults access care from licensed therapists with experience navigating the unique issues faced later in life.
